異構無線傳感器網絡的密鑰設置方法,其特征在于步驟一:構建三層異構網絡結構;步驟二:在有限域GF(q)上產生若干個t階對稱二元多項式,S個t階對稱二元多項式構成N×N的對稱矩陣A,每個能力強的節點存儲一個上三角矩陣的某一行向量j和相應的下三角矩陣的列向量j,同時將該某一行向量j的行數j作為ID號保存,以及保存一個Hash函數;步驟三:能力強的節點(H-sensor)、普通傳感器節點(L-sensor)的密鑰預分配:步驟四:能力強的節點(H-sensor)間會話密鑰的生成;步驟五;能力強的節點(H-sensor)與普通傳感器節點(L-sensor)會話密鑰的生成。本[發明專利]與已有技術相比,具有進一步平衡無線傳感器網絡能量消耗與安全性之間的關系,在降低整個網絡存儲消耗的基礎上,提高了網絡的安全性,使網絡節點實現100%抗捕獲攻擊能力的優點。